Mobile message control
23 June 2014
Messagemaker has increased the interactivity of its digital LED signs and displays by providing direct control from a mobile device.

The new instant messaging solution utilises the TwittLED range of moving message displays for health and safety applications and also offers the capability to stream live Twitter feeds.
With control from a PC, and now a mobile phone or tablet, the TwittLED’s immediacy and queuing capacities – the last 10 messages, announcements or ‘tweets’ are shown – also enables health and safety messages to be refreshed and displayed constantly. This allows instant messages, warnings, announcements etc to be made and will also help to reinforce policy guidelines.
